Instructions
Preheat oven to 350°. Cook macaroni according to package directions for al dente.
Meanwhile, in a large saucepan, heat butter over medium heat. Stir in flour, salt and pepper until smooth; gradually whisk in milk. Bring to a boil, stirring constantly; cook and stir 2-3 minutes or until thickened.
Reduce heat. Stir in 3 cups cheese and Worcestershire sauce until cheese is melted.
Drain macaroni; stir into sauce.
Transfer to a greased 10-in. ovenproof skillet.
Bake, uncovered, 20 minutes. Top with remaining cheese; sprinkle with paprika.
Bake 5-10 minutes longer or until bubbly and cheese is melted.
